Located in the bustling city of London, Honor Oak Park Train Station serves as a gateway for both locals and tourists crisscrossing the city or heading to various destinations. With a rich history and a welcoming community vibe, the station is more than just a stop—it's a critical link in the London Overground network.
Honor Oak Park is equipped with convenient facilities, making your journey as smooth as possible. The station's ticket office is open during the morning peak hours, and for those purchasing tickets in advance, there are ticket machines available to collect them. The facility is quite accommodating with step-free access throughout, ensuring ease of movement for everyone, including parents with prams or travelers with mobility aids.
While the station lacks some amenities like bicycle storage and on-site shops, there is a cozy coffee shop perfect for grabbing a quick refreshment. If you're in need of help, customer services are well-organized with help points and live information screens for arrivals and departures. If you require assistance on your journey, both national rail and London’s Overground offer comprehensive support to tailor travel to your needs.
The surrounding area of Honor Oak Park offers various onward travel solutions. For those looking to continue their journey by bus, stops near the station provide routes heading towards key locations like Crystal Palace and London Bridge. If you prefer the privacy of a taxi, services like Addison Lee and Gett can be conveniently arranged. Ainsdale Station is packed with useful facilities to make your travel as hassle-free as possible. The ticket office opens bright and early at 05:32 and closes late, at precisely 00:27, catering to both early birds and night owls. You can purchase and collect tickets right at the station, although it's worth noting there are no automated ticket machines available.
If you need a helping hand, staff are readily available throughout the week. CCTV is in place for added security, and there are customer help points to provide you with all the information you might need during your journey. Whether you're waiting for a train or just passing through, seating areas are available for your comfort.
Accessibility is a highlight at Ainsdale, with step-free access to all platforms and staff assistance available if required. While accessible ticket machines aren't present, an induction loop system ensures those with hearing impairments can access information easily. Crucially, the platform and the station are accessible via a level crossing, though a footbridge does connect them, offering both convenience and flexibility.
Ainsdale Station may not have a taxi rank, but it does boast excellent bus connections. Rail replacement services can be found on nearby Shore Road, and Merseytravel provides comprehensive options for onward travel. Whether you require a bus or plan on exploring the region further, information can be sourced through the local Traveline service, ensuring that you can get where you need to go without a hitch.
For those flying in or out of the area, Liverpool John Lennon Airport is the nearest airport. Conveniently, you can purchase a combined rail and bus ticket to get there efficiently from any Merseyrail station, making it an excellent choice for passengers looking to fly without the stress of separate ticketing.
